Hammonds Plains has a maritime climate—year‑round rainfall, coastal moisture and periodic heavy snowfall with freeze–thaw cycles that stress roofing materials. In this setting, metal roofs commonly last 40–70+ years, while asphalt shingles typically have shorter lifespans (often 15–30 years) because they degrade faster from moisture, UV and freeze‑thaw cycling. Coastal moisture and salt air can accelerate corrosion for some metals and fasteners; heavy winter snow and freeze–thaw cycles increase loading and cycling stresses—so good flashing, fastening and corrosion‑resistant materials matter. Homeowners choose durable systems for long‑term protection, reduced maintenance and better wind/snow performance. Short answer: it varies — metal roofs usually cost more up front than asphalt shingles, but many Hammonds Plains homeowners look at lifetime value rather than initial price. Costs depend on roof size, pitch and complexity (multiple hips, valleys, skylights), tear‑off and disposal, flashing and fasteners, and labour/contractor rates. Local construction factors — access, permits and qualified installers in the Halifax region — can raise price. In Hammonds Plains, coastal moisture (salt‑laden air and higher humidity) and regular freeze–thaw cycles increase the need for corrosion‑resistant coatings, durable underlayments and robust flashing, which influence material choice and labour time. Those investments often reduce future repair and replacement costs by preventing corrosion, leaks and ice‑dam damage. Hammonds Plains gets frequent precipitation, significant winter snow and freeze–thaw cycles, and coastal humidity that can accelerate moisture-related wear—factors that affect roof life and corrosion risk. – Lifespan: Asphalt shingles typically last ~15–25 years in this climate; quality metal roofs often last 40+ years. – Maintenance: Shingles need regular inspections, moss/ice-dam mitigation and periodic replacement; metal needs less frequent upkeep but requires corrosion checks near the coast. – Durability: Metal resists wind, snow loads and freeze–thaw damage better; shingles are more vulnerable to granule loss and ice-dam leaks. – Long-term value: Metal has higher upfront cost but lower replacement frequency and better resale appeal. Homeowners prioritising long-term protection and low replacement risk often choose metal; those on tight budgets may prefer shingles. This is a common myth. Modern residential metal roofs installed over solid decking do not sound like barn roofs. Perceived noise from rain depends on insulation, attic space and the roof assembly—underlayment, sheathing and ventilation all help dampen sound. Installation quality matters: correct fastening, proper underlayment and a continuous deck reduce vibration and noise. When properly specified and installed, residential metal roofs in Hammonds Plains are typically similar in sound to asphalt shingle or tile roofs rather than loud metal barns. Hammonds Plains, NS experiences Atlantic‑influenced weather: nor’easters and winter storms with heavy snow, freezing rain and strong coastal winds, as well as summer thunderstorms and occasional hail; storms have produced local gusts approaching or exceeding 100 km/h in the region. Metal roofing can perform very well in wind, hail and heavy weather when the system is properly designed, attached and maintained: panels resist uplift and water intrusion, metal tolerates impact better than many materials, and smooth surfaces shed snow and ice. Performance depends on roofing system design, installation quality and material durability. Homeowners consider weather resilience to reduce leak risk, storm damage, insurance costs and long‑term maintenance. Corrosion and rust resistance in metal roofing depends on the type of metal used. Steel, copper and aluminium behave differently: some alloys and coatings resist corrosion far better than plain steel. In wet or coastal locations like Hammonds Plains, NS, aluminium performs especially well because it naturally forms a protective oxide layer and resists salt‑air corrosion. Homeowners should prioritise corrosion resistance to extend roof lifespan, reduce maintenance and prevent leaks, structural damage and higher replacement costs. Metal roofing in Hammonds Plains, Nova Scotia is a durable, low-maintenance roofing option, but it is not maintenance-free. Homeowners should perform periodic inspections—after storms, heavy snow, or in spring and fall—to check for debris, damaged sections, and blocked gutters. Pay particular attention to flashing, roof penetrations (vents, chimneys, skylights) and fasteners; these are common sources of leaks. Remove accumulated branches, leaves, salt spray, and ice dams promptly and clear gutters to avoid trapped moisture. Significant weather events can dislodge panels or compromise seals, so inspect sooner after storms. With routine checks and prompt attention to debris and flashing, metal roofs provide long‑lasting protection with minimal labour and upkeep.
